An Espresso Coffee Maker Brings a Cafe-Like Experience to Your Home

An espresso coffee maker can bring a cafe-like experience into your home. These machines use high temperatures and pressure to create espresso, a drink full of flavor that can be used to create drinks such as cappuccinos and lattes.

Select an espresso machine that has the features you need. Some models have a built-in milk frother, grinder, and other accessories that can increase the number of drinks you can prepare.

Espresso: How to Get Started

A high-quality espresso machine can make a cup of cafe-quality coffee at home. Espresso uses high pressure steam to force through the grounds, unlike pour-over and drip coffee brewing. This can add another brew variable that can be controlled and bring out aromas and flavors that other methods don't get. But, espresso can be more difficult to make at home than other methods of brewing.

The most crucial aspect of making a successful shot however, is selecting the most suitable beans. It is also important to be aware of the size of your grind as well as the timing of the extraction. The ideal size of grind is smaller than sugar granules and the extraction time should be between 25 seconds. If your shot appears too fast, you'll need to adjust the size of your grind and reverse the process.

The color of the crema, which is the thick layer golden foam that forms over a well-pulled cup of espresso, is a reliable indicator of quality. A light-colored crema could mean that your coffee is too old or isn't producing enough pressure when you brew. A dark crema is often an indication of over-roasted, or burnt coffee, which could also affect the flavor. If you notice visible "channels" through the grounds, it means your grinder isn't tamping evenly that can be corrected by an improved grinder or increased the tamping pressure.

Make sure to keep Your Machine Clean

Clean espresso machines are vital to produce the finest tasting coffee. A machine that is dirty can give a bitter taste and clog filters and drips, which requires frequent cleaning. The good news is that this process is simple and will extend the lifespan of your machine. To maximize the value of your investment, it is crucial to follow the manufacturer's instructions.

Rinsing the water screen and filter basket with warm, clear tap water is all you need to clean an espresso machine. Based on how often you use it, some parts of the machine may need to be cleaned more frequently, including the portafilter and group head.

Every few days You should clean the group head and the water screen with a brush and soapy hot water to wash away any coffee residue. Every three to four months, it's also a good idea to flush the espresso machine back by filling the tank with white vinegar and ice water and letting it sit for two hours and then flushing the system with hot water to remove any remaining residue.

To clean the espresso machine, take it apart it and clean all removable components with hot soapy water. Be sure to clean the drip tray on a regular basis, as it will accumulate coffee grounds and spilled water which can block drains and attract insects. Finally, be sure to keep a separate damp rag that is only used for wiping the steam wand, to avoid cross contamination.
